Specifications and Models of Outdoor Cable Trays

Specifications and Models of Outdoor Cable Trays

Outdoor cable trays are engineered for mechanical strength, corrosion resistance, environmental durability, and proper cable support, with material and design selected based on exposure conditions and load requirements.Materials and Corrosion ResistanceOutdoor cable trays are typically made from steel, aluminum, stainless steel, or fiberglass-reinforced plastic (FRP), each offering distinct advantages:Steel: Often hot-dip galvanized (HDG) or pre-galvanized to resist corrosion; economical and strong but susceptible to saltwater and chemical exposure if unprotected .Aluminum: Lightweight, naturally corrosion-resistant due to a protective oxide layer; suitable for coastal or humid environments .Stainless Steel (316SS): Superior resistance to harsh marine, chemical, or industrial environments; ideal for areas with high chloride or acidic exposure .FRP: Non-conductive, UV-resistant, and chemically inert; excellent for corrosive or sensitive electronic environments, though more expensive . Environmental factors such as salt spray, chemical fumes, acidic rain, high humidity, and solar radiant heat must be considered when selecting materials .Mechanical Strength and Load CapacityOutdoor trays must support the weight of installed cables and withstand environmental stresses:Span and support spacing: Determines tray deflection and load capacity; longer spans require stronger materials or additional supports .Impact resistance: Important in areas prone to debris or mechanical contact.Cable support: Ladder and perforated trays provide better ventilation and even support, reducing insulation stress .Types of Outdoor Cable TraysLadder trays: Open design, excellent for heat dissipation, suitable for power cables with high ampacity; rungs typically spaced 6–12 inches .Perforated trays: Ventilated bottom, good for small-diameter cables, moderate heat dissipation.Solid-bottom trays: Provide maximum protection from debris and moisture but limit airflow; suitable for sensitive or low-heat cables .Wire mesh trays: Lightweight, flexible, and easy to install; ideal for frequent reconfigurations or fiber optic/data cables .Thermal and Electrical ConsiderationsHeat dissipation: Open designs like ladder or wire mesh trays allow natural cooling, preventing overheating of power cables .Grounding: Metallic trays can serve as part of the grounding system if designed per code (e.g., NEC Article 392), .Non-conductivity: FRP trays are preferred where electrical isolation is required.Installation and Operational FactorsWeight and handling: Aluminum and FRP are lighter than steel, reducing labor and installation costs .Fabrication flexibility: Consider the number of bends, elbows, tees, and reducers required for the project.Maintenance and lifecycle cost: Stainless steel and FRP have higher initial costs but lower maintenance in corrosive environments; HDG steel is cost-effective but may require periodic inspection .SummarySelecting an outdoor cable tray involves balancing material properties, mechanical strength, environmental resistance, thermal performance, and cost. Ladder trays are preferred for power cables due to heat dissipation, while solid or FRP trays are ideal for sensitive or corrosive environments. Proper design ensures long-term reliability, safety, and compliance with electrical codes .
